ATTORNEY DISCIPLINARY .PROCEEDING
Respondent, Randall J. Cashio, seeks review of a ruling of the disciplinary board imposing a public reprimand. Having reviewed the record and the briefs of the parties, we find the Office of Disciplinary Counsel failed to prove the charged misconduct by clear and' convincing evidence.
[940]*940Accordingly, it is the judgment of this court that the formal charges be and hereby are dismissed.
